Paperback. Condición: new. Paperback. In an era of political theater and manufactured outrage, one voice has consistently cut through the noise with unvarnished truth. TESTING NEGATIVE FOR STUPIDITY is a powerful declaration of intellectual independence and a masterclass in clear thinking from one of the Senate's most candid and… effective legislators. This is not a standard political memoir. It is a riveting journey from the small-town values of Zachary, Louisiana, to the tumultuous heart of Washington, D.C., chronicling a career built on a simple, radical idea: say what you mean and mean what you say. With the sharp wit and plainspoken clarity that has become his trademark, the author reveals how his upbringing, forged in the crucible of his family's demanding work ethic and a memorable lesson in confronting bullies, shaped a political philosophy immune to the capital's corrupting influences. More than a political chronicle, this book is an actionable manifesto for reclaiming American common sense. The author tackles the nation's most pressing issues from the crisis at the southern border and the weaponization of the justice system to the disastrous retreat from law and order, with solutions that are as straightforward as they are effective. He makes a compelling case for legal immigration, energy dominance, parental rights in education, and a foreign policy that projects strength rather than apology. TESTING NEGATIVE FOR STUPIDITY is a clarion call for a return to principle over party, courage over conformity, and clear-eyed reality over woke delusion. It is an essential read for any citizen who believes that America's greatest days are still ahead, but only if we dare to name our problems and the wisdom to solve them.
